Send us a text The history of modern Israel is so often linked to the founding of the state in 1948. Failing to consider the pre-history of a conflict that many would argue kicked off in force with the Hebron Massacre of 1929. Yardena Schwartz has had an esteemed career as an award-winning journalist and Emmy-nominated producer and is now the author of Ghosts of a Holy War: The 1929 Massacre in Palestine That Ignited the Arab-Israeli Conflict.
